Toggle navigation
iBegin.com
USA
Canada
UK
New Zealand
Submit Business
Register
Login
Search for:
around
Search
Search
Local Directory
United States
Florida
Tampa
The Oasis at Highwoods Preserve
Photos
The Oasis at Highwoods Preserve
18311 Highwoods Preserve Parkway, Tampa, Florida 33647
(844) 577-4543
Information
Map
Photos
Contact
Photos for The Oasis at Highwoods Preserve